The SBG2045CT-T-F has a standard TO-220AB package with three pins. The pin configuration is as follows: 1. Pin 1: Anode 2. Pin 2: Cathode 3. Pin 3: Anode
Advantages: - Low forward voltage drop - Fast recovery time - High temperature operation
Disadvantages: - Higher cost compared to standard diodes - Sensitive to reverse voltage spikes
The SBG2045CT-T-F operates based on the Schottky barrier principle, where a metal-semiconductor junction provides low forward voltage drop and fast switching characteristics.
This rectifier is widely used in power supplies, DC-DC converters, and other electronic circuits requiring efficient power rectification. It is suitable for applications where high efficiency and fast switching are crucial.
